The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of Auguste Pfeiffer, born in 1824 in , consisted of 3 members. Auguste was the head of the household, married to Annie Pfeiffer, born in 1829 in Woodlands, Wiltshire, England.
During the period, also present in the household was Auguste's Visitor, John Marmion, born in 1854 in Ireland.
